Title:
PRODUCTION OF MOTHER MOLD AND MASTER PLATE SUITABLE TO BE USED FOR THIS METHOD

Abstract:

PURPOSE: To form bump-like information bits in a recording layer in such a manner that the longitudinal dimension of the information bit differs along the direction of information tracks by forming a specified double layer of a synthetic resin for the recording layer.

CONSTITUTION: The substrate 1 has a recording double layer 4 of a synthetic resin on one surface. The first synthetic resin layer 2 of the recording double layer 4 adjacent to the substrate 4 has a rather high coefft. of expansion and lower glass transition temp. than room temp., and the second synthetic resin layer 3 bonded to the first layer 2 has a rather low coefft. of expansion and higher glass transition temp. than room temp. The both synthetic resin layers 2, 3 contain a dye which absorbs laser beam 5 used, and when the layers are irradiated with the beam 5, bump-like information bits are formed in the recording layer 4 in such a manner that the longitudinal dimension of the information bit differs along the direction of information tracks and that the width of the bits perpendicular to the information tracks is same or almost same. thereby producing bumps having almost same width and different longitudinal dimension which is accurately formed without causing local changes in the size of bumps.
